Taro Logo

Big Data Developer

Global financial services company providing banking, investment, and wealth management services.
Data
Mid-Level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Finance

Description For Big Data Developer

Barclays is seeking a talented Big Data Developer to join their team in Prague. This role presents an exciting opportunity to work at the intersection of finance and technology, where you'll be responsible for designing and developing sophisticated software solutions that power Barclays' data infrastructure.

As a Big Data Developer, you'll be working with cutting-edge technologies including Scala, Java, and various Big Data technologies such as Spark, Hive, and Impala. You'll be part of a dynamic team that values technical excellence and innovation, while contributing to solutions that directly impact the bank's operations and customer experience.

The role requires a strong foundation in software engineering principles, with particular emphasis on big data processing and distributed systems. You'll be working in an Agile environment, collaborating with cross-functional teams to deliver robust, scalable solutions. The position offers the opportunity to work with enterprise-scale data systems while maintaining high standards of security and performance.

Key aspects of the role include developing high-quality software solutions, participating in code reviews, implementing secure coding practices, and staying current with industry trends. The ideal candidate will have experience with both object-oriented and functional programming paradigms, strong database design skills, and familiarity with DevOps practices.

This position is perfect for someone who wants to advance their career in big data development while working for a leading global financial institution. You'll have the opportunity to work on challenging projects, contribute to technical decisions, and help shape the future of Barclays' data infrastructure. The role offers exposure to enterprise-scale systems and the chance to work with a talented team of professionals in a collaborative environment.

Last updated 12 days ago

Responsibilities For Big Data Developer

  • Development and delivery of high-quality software solutions using industry aligned programming languages, frameworks, and tools
  • Cross-functional collaboration with product managers, designers, and other engineers
  • Participate in code reviews and promote code quality and knowledge sharing
  • Stay informed of industry technology trends and innovations
  • Implement secure coding practices to protect sensitive data
  • Implement effective unit testing practices

Requirements For Big Data Developer

Scala
Java
MongoDB
  • Previous practical experience with Scala OR proficiency in Java programming
  • Experience with Big Data/Hadoop Technologies such as Spark, Hive or Impala
  • Strong knowledge of OOP and functional programming principles
  • Strong database design fundamentals
  • Experience with DevOps, source control, unit and integration testing
  • Familiarity with Agile methodologies

Jobs Related To Barclays Big Data Developer